I live in Boston, and am looking to buy a Chimay gift set as a
Christmas gift for a friend. This is a package that includes a Chimay glass and three 33cl bottles of their beers -- one each of the red, white, and blue. I bought such a set for myself a couple of years ago, but I was living in a different city, at the time. I've found this set listed at one online store, so I'm pretty sure they still exist, but for various reasons I can't order from said online store. Can anyone suggest a place in the Boston area where I might find this? Any assistance much appreciated. Eric Lorenzo |
